本文目录导读:
HTML(HyperText Markup Language)是构成网页文档的主要标记语言,它定义了如何将文本、图片、链接等元素组织成结构化的文档,并通过浏览器展示给用户,自1990年代初诞生以来,HTML已经经历了多次更新和扩展,从最初的HTML 1.0到现在的HTML5,其功能性和兼容性得到了极大的提升。
HTML的历史与发展
HTML 1.0 - 简单的开始
HTML最初是由Tim Berners-Lee在1989年发明的,用于分享物理实验室的研究信息,当时的HTML非常简单,仅包含一些基础的标签如<a>
(锚点)、<img>
(图像)等,这些标签能够帮助人们创建简单的超文本链接和信息共享平台。
HTML 2.0 - 基础增强
随着互联网的发展,HTML 2.0于1993年发布,增加了对表格、列表和表单的支持,使得网页的表现形式更加丰富多样,这一版本奠定了HTML作为网页标准的基础。
图片来源于网络,如有侵权联系删除
HTML 3.2 - 图形与颜色
1996年发布的HTML 3.2引入了图形支持,允许网页中嵌入图像,并且可以设置背景颜色,这极大地丰富了网页的设计风格,使网页更具吸引力。
HTML 4.0 - 结构化与国际化
1997年的HTML 4.0进一步强调了文档的结构化,通过引入语义化的标签如<header>
、<nav>
、<article>
等,提高了网页的可读性和可维护性,该版本还增加了对多种字符编码和国际字符集的支持,促进了全球网络的互联互通。
HTML 5 - 现代Web开发的里程碑
2008年开始制定的HTML 5规范,经过多年的发展和完善,终于在2014年正式成为W3C的标准,HTML 5不仅继承了前几版的所有特性,还引入了许多新的元素和属性,如 <video>
、<audio>
、<canvas>
等,为开发者提供了更多的工具来创建交互式内容和丰富的用户体验。
HTML的关键特性
元素与属性
HTML文档由一系列的元素组成,每个元素都有特定的用途和格式。<h1>
用于标题,<p>
用于段落,而<a>
则用来创建超链接,元素的属性则用于描述元素的特征或行为,href
属性指定链接的目标地址。
标签与语义化
HTML中的标签具有明确的语义意义,可以帮助搜索引擎理解页面的内容,语义化的标签也有助于提高代码的可读性和可维护性,使用 <article>
标签表示一篇独立的文章,而不是简单地用 <div>
来包裹内容。
图片来源于网络,如有侵权联系删除
表单与多媒体
HTML 5 引入了大量的新标签和API,使得创建复杂的表单和多媒体体验变得更加容易。<input type="range">
可以用来创建滑动条控件,而 <video>
和 <audio>
标签可以直接嵌入视频和音频文件。
Web API 与交互性
除了基本的HTML结构外,HTML还结合JavaScript和其他客户端技术,实现了丰富的动态交互效果,通过DOM(Document Object Model)接口,开发者可以对HTML文档进行操作和管理;而通过事件处理机制,可以实现按钮点击、鼠标移动等交互动作。
尽管HTML已经成为Web开发不可或缺的工具之一,但未来的发展仍然充满机遇和挑战,随着物联网(IoT)、虚拟现实(VR)和增强现实(AR)技术的兴起,HTML需要不断适应新的需求和技术趋势,预计未来版本的HTML将会继续增加更多实用的元素和强大的API,以支持更复杂的应用场景和创新应用的开发。
HTML作为构建现代网络世界的重要基础,其历史和发展历程见证了互联网技术的进步和变革,无论是对于初学者还是经验丰富的开发者来说,深入理解和掌握HTML都是迈向成功之路的关键一步,让我们共同期待HTML的未来,探索更多可能性!
标签: #html网站
评论列表